So two times in the past week I got scammed. I don't usually fall for so many things but I guess I am so desperate to earn some real income I am willing to try all kind of things. So the first scam was mycashtable, it was an online website, if you promote their link- they give you 25 dollars to sign up and 10 dollars for each person you sign up. Believe it or not , that part was easy, within 48 hours I had just over 700 dollars. Only when it is time to cash out they send you to never ending surveys and you don't earn anything. Scam number two was a mystery shopping job. I really thought it was for real and when I received a priority envelope from the company with a cashier's check and a letter with the information what to do, for sure I thought wow finally a real one. I tell my daughter, change of plans we are going to the bank and going on a shopping excursion if you will. So I go to the bank it is written on and cash the check, only to sit there for 15 minutes waiting for the teller to tell me the check is fake. He said it truly looked real and it is even a real account number but, I guess their is record of cashier's check and no record of the check that was given to me so they could not cash. I am so glad I went to the bank and found out the hard was it was a scam as if I would have cashed in Amscot or walmart or something they probably would have cashed and then they would have come after me for the money, that of course I would have spent on the things they wanted me to evaluate, moneygram. I really should have known it was all too good to be true, but with my personal situations not being at their best right now I felt like I should at least try.

I am so glad the bank caught that scam for you! It is so nasty that people want to scam one another. Mystery shopping companies send you money AFTER you do the job and submit the report and the client accepts the report. Most pay once a month the month after you do the work.
